文章對於this的解釋也不盡相同,本篇文章試圖厘清JS中函數與this的關系。 一、JS中函數的寫法 ...
轉載 原文地址:https: www.cnblogs.com hailun p .html ES 標准新增了一種新的函數:Arrow Function 箭頭函數 相當於: 箭頭函數相當於匿名函數,並且簡化了函數定義。箭頭函數有兩種格式,一種像上面的,只包含一個表達式,連 ... 和return都省略掉了。還有一種可以包含多條語句,這時候就不能省略 ... 和return: 如果參數不是一個,就需要 ...
2018-12-18 19:29 0 6483 推薦指數:
文章對於this的解釋也不盡相同,本篇文章試圖厘清JS中函數與this的關系。 一、JS中函數的寫法 ...
箭頭函數是ES6標准中新增的一種函數,在詳細的討論箭頭函數之前,我們先來看看函數的四種定義方式 函數的四種定義方式 1、函數聲明的方式(常用) 注意函數定義最后沒有加分號。必須有名字,會函數提升,在預解析階段就已經創建,聲明前后都可以調用。 2、函數 ...
function方法調用call和apply的使用方式:https://developer.mozilla.org/zh-CN/doc ...
generater跟函數很像: function* fn(x){ yield x; yield x++; return x;} 如上所示,generater用function*定義,可以用yield返回多次,也可以使用return返回; 調用generater有兩個 ...
我們知道在ES6中,引入了箭頭函數,其本質就是等同有ES5中的函數。類似於下面的寫法: let test1=() => “abc”; let test2=() => { return “abc”}; let sum=(a,b) => a+b ...
obj 箭頭函數:箭頭函數本身是沒有this和arguments的,在箭頭函數中引用this實際上是調用 ...
四種基本用法 1. 一般方法中,this代指全局對象 window 2. 作為對象方法調用,this代指當前對象 3. 作為構造函數調用,this 指代new 出的對象 4. 調用方法的apply和call方法,可以改變函數的調用對象/作用域 (this)用法 ...
JS中的this JS中this的指向一般可以直接歸成一條規律 ====》 函數中的this function f1(){ return this; } f1() === window; // true 網上分析較多,因而將其匯總:函數中的this 一般都指向調用這個函數的對象 直接寫在 ...